# Cleric Features
|
|
class ChannelDivinity(Feature):
|
|
"""At 2nd level, you gain the ability to channel divine energy directly from
|
|
your deity, using that energy to fuel magical effects. You start with two
|
|
such effects: Turn Undead and an effect determined by your domain. Some
|
|
domains grant you additional effects as you advance in levels, as noted in
|
|
the domain description.
|
|
|
|
When you use your Channel Divinity, you choose which effect to create. You
|
|
must then finish a short or long rest to use your Channel Divinity again.
|
|
|
|
Some Channel Divinity effects require saving throws. When you use such an
|
|
effect from this class, the DC equals your cleric spell save DC.
|
|
|
|
Beginning at 6th level, you can use your Channel Divinity twice between
|
|
rests, and beginning at 18th level you can use it three times between
|
|
rests. When you finish a short or long rest, you regain your expended uses.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
_name = "Channel Divinity"
|
|
source = "Cleric"
|
|
|
|
@property
|
|
def name(self):
|
|
level = self.owner.Cleric.level
|
|
if level < 6:
|
|
return "Channel Divinity (1x/SR)"
|
|
elif level < 18:
|
|
return "Channel Divinity (2x/SR)"
|
|
else:
|
|
return "Channel Divinity (3x/SR)"
|
|
|
|
|
|
class TurnUndead(Feature):
|
|
"""As an action, you present your holy symbol and speak a prayer censuring the
|
|
undead. Each undead that can see or hear you within 30 feet of you must
|
|
make a Wisdom saving throw. If the creature fails its saving throw, it is
|
|
turned for 1 minute or until it takes any damage.
|
|
|
|
A turned creature must spend its turns trying to move as far away from you
|
|
as it can, and it can't willingly move to a space within 30 feet of you. It
|
|
also can't take reactions. For its action, it can use only the Dash action
|
|
or try to escape from an effect that prevents it from moving. If there's
|
|
nowhere to move, the creature can use the Dodge action.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Channel Divinity: Turn Undead"
|
|
source = "Cleric"
|
|
|
|
|
|
class DestroyUndead(Feature):
|
|
"""Starting at 5th level, when an undead fails its saving throw against your
|
|
Turn Undead feature, the creature is instantly destroyed if its challenge
|
|
rating is at or below a certain threshold, as shown in the Destroy Undead
|
|
table.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
_name = "Destroy Undead"
|

class DivineIntervention(Feature):
|
|
"""Beginning at 10th level, you can call on your deity to intervene on your
|
|
behalf when your need is great.
|
|
|
|
Imploring your deity's aid requires you to use your action. Describe the
|
|
assistance you seek, and roll percentile dice. If you roll a number equal
|
|
to or lower than your cleric level, your deity intervenes. The DM chooses
|
|
the nature of the intervention; the effect of any cleric spell or cleric
|
|
domain spell would be appropriate.
|
|
|
|
If your deity intervenes, you can't use this feature again for 7
|
|
days. Otherwise, you can use it again after you finish a long rest.
|
|
|
|
At 20th level, your call for intervention succeeds automatically, no roll
|
|
required.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Divine Intervention"
|
|
source = "Cleric"

# Life Domain
|
|
class DiscipleOfLife(Feature):
|
|
"""Also starting at 1st level, your healing spells are more
|
|
effective. Whenever you use a spell of 1st level or higher to restore hit
|
|
points to a creature, the creature regains additional hit points equal to 2
|
|
+ the spell's level
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Disciple of Life"
|
|
source = "Cleric (Life Domain)"
|
|
|
|
|
|
class PreserveLife(ChannelDivinity):
|
|
"""Starting at 2nd level, you can use your Channel Divinity to heal the badly
|
|
injured. As an action, you present your holy symbol and evoke healing
|
|
energy that can restore a number of hit points equal to five times your
|
|
cleric level. Choose any creatures within 30 feet of you, and divide those
|
|
hit points among them. This feature can restore a creature to no more than
|
|
half of its hit point maximum. You can't use this feature on an undead or a
|
|
construct.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Channel Divinity: Preserve Life"
|
|
source = "Cleric (Life Domain)"
|
|
|
|
|
|
class BlessedHealer(Feature):
|
|
"""Beginning at 6th level, the healing spells you cast on others heal you as
|
|
well. When you cast a spell of 1st level or higher that restores hit points
|
|
to a creature other than you, you regain hit points equal to 2 + the
|
|
spell's level.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Blessed Healer"
|
|
source = "Cleric (Life Domain)"
|
|
|
|
|
|
class DivineStrikeLife(DivineStrike):
|
|
"""At 8th level, you gain the ability to infuse your weapon strikes with
|
|
divine energy. Once on each o f your turns when you hit a creature with a
|
|
weapon attack, you can cause the attack to deal an extra 1d8 radiant damage
|
|
to the target. When you reach 14th level, the extra damage increases to
|
|
2d8.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
source = "Cleric (Life Domain)"
|
|
|
|
|
|
class SupremeHealing(Feature):
|
|
"""Starting at 17th level, when you would normally roll one or more dice to
|
|
restore hit points with a spell, you instead use the highest number
|
|
possible for each die. For example, instead of restoring 2d6 hit points to
|
|
a creature, you restore 12.
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Supreme Healing"
|
|
source = "Cleric (Life Domain)"

# Arcana Domain
|
|
class ArcaneInitiate(Feature):
|
|
"""When you choose this domain at 1st level, you gain proficiency in the
|
|
Arcana skill, and you gain two cantrips of your choice from the wizard
|
|
spell list. For you, these cantrips count as cleric cantrips
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Arcane Initiate"
|
|
source = "Cleric (Arcana Domain)"
|
|
|
|
|
|
class ArcaneAbjuration(ChannelDivinity):
|
|
"""Starting at 2nd level, you can use your Channel Divinity to abjure
|
|
otherworldly creatures. As an action, you present your holy symbol, and one
|
|
celestial, elemental, fey, or fiend of your choice that is within 30 feet
|
|
of you must make a Wisdom saving throw, provided that the creature can see
|
|
or hear you. If the creature fails its saving throw, it is turned for 1
|
|
minute or until it takes any damage.
|
|
|
|
A turned creature must spend its turns trying to move as far away from you
|
|
as it can, and it can't willingly end its move in a space within 30 feet of
|
|
you. It also can't take reactions. For its action, it can only use the Dash
|
|
action or try to escape from an effect that prevents it from moving. If
|
|
there's nowhere to move, the creature can use the Dodge action.
|
|
|
|
After you reach 5th level, when a creature fails its saving throw against
|
|
your Arcane Abjuration feature, the creature is banished for 1 minute (as
|
|
in the banishment spell, no concentration required) if it isn't on its
|
|
plane of origin and its challenge rating is at or below a certain
|
|
threshold, as shown on the Arcane Banishment table.
|
|
|
|
5th level : CR 1/2
|
|
8th level : CR 1
|
|
11th level : CR 2
|
|
14th level : CR 3
|
|
17th level : CR 4
|
|
|
|
"""
|
|
name = "Channel Divinity: Arcane Abjuration"
|
|
source = "Cleric (Arcana Domain)"
